Top 10 Best Offline Android Apps
Here are ten of the best offline Android apps that stand out for their usability, design, and value:
1. Spotify (Premium) – Music App Without Internet
Spotify Premium allows you to download music and listen offline, making it one of the top choices for a music app without internet. Whether you’re commuting, flying, or working out in a remote area, Spotify ensures your playlists are available wherever you are.
-
Offline Feature: Download songs, albums, or podcasts.
-
Bonus: Personalized playlists and superior sound quality.
2. Google Translate
Ideal for travelers and language learners, Google Translate lets you download entire language packs so you can translate text, images, or conversations without an internet connection.
-
Offline Feature: Over 50 languages available for offline translation.
-
Use Case: International travel, language practice.
3. Pocket
Pocket is perfect for saving articles, news, and videos to read later. You can download content while online and access it offline at your convenience.
-
Offline Feature: Stores content for offline reading.
-
Use Case: Research, leisure reading during travel.
4. Evernote
Evernote is a powerful note-taking app that lets you sync and access notes across multiple devices. The offline mode allows you to write, edit, and view notes without connectivity.
-
Offline Feature: Access notebooks without internet.
-
Use Case: Project planning, to-do lists, journaling.
5. Netflix (Offline Downloads)
The Netflix app allows users to download select TV shows and movies for offline viewing. This makes long flights or remote getaways more enjoyable and screen-friendly.
-
Offline Feature: Downloadable content for watching later.
-
Use Case: Entertainment during commutes or travel.
6. Google Maps
One of the most essential tools for navigation, Google Maps offers offline maps functionality that lets you download entire cities or regions for turn-by-turn directions without an internet connection.
-
Offline Feature: Maps with search and navigation.
-
Use Case: Road trips, international travel.
7. Audible
Audible’s audiobook collection can be downloaded for offline listening, making it a great alternative to music when you want to learn or relax.
-
Offline Feature: Download audiobooks and listen without internet.
-
Use Case: Commuting, long flights, bedtime stories.
8. WPS Office
WPS Office lets you read, edit, and create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and PDF documents offline, offering a full productivity suite without needing to connect.
-
Offline Feature: Full functionality for office tasks.
-
Use Case: Working remotely, studying.
9. CamScanner
Need to scan documents on the go? CamScanner allows you to scan and store documents offline. You can later sync or email them when you’re back online.
-
Offline Feature: Document scanning and saving.
-
Use Case: Work-related documentation, academic notes.
10. Musicolet – Offline Music Player
Musicolet is a completely offline music app without internet and doesn’t require subscriptions or internet access. It’s lightweight and packed with features like equalizers and multiple queues.
-
Offline Feature: Local music playback with no internet dependency.
-
Use Case: Offline audio playback, music organization.
